The AW-SYL-2352 is a Wi-Fi-capable PID controller based on Auber's SYL-2352 1/16 DIN PID controller with SSR output. This unit not only does everything a regular SYL-2352 does but also has 2.4 GHz Wi-Fi connectivity, which allows a user to access the controller remotely through the AuberWifi phone app anywhere that has an internet connection.

Wi-Fi Connectivity Features:

  • The AuberWifi app is available for both iOS and Android systems. 
  • Monitor the current sensor reading, view the data plot, and export historical data.
  • Monitor the status of the main output, and the alarm relays.
  • Access and change all parameters from the app. 
  • Receive alarm notifications pushed to your phone. 
  • Easy pairing process. Compatible with most modern routers with 2.4 GHz WiFi bands.  
  • Manage multiple AuberWifi (AW) series devices in one app. 
  • Capable of receiving updates over-the-air (OTA).

Basic Features of SYL-2352

This PID controller has a dual-line display and is 1/16 DIN size (1.89" x1.89" or 48 mm x 48 mm). The temperature management of industrial equipment, laboratory equipment, espresso machines, beer brewing systems, BBQ grills/smokers, heat treatment ovens, glass kilns, and aquariums are just a few common uses for this controller.

The controller employs a PID algorithm with advanced artificial intelligence that is capable of handling systems that are often slow or challenging to operate with a traditional PID controller. The temperature will be maintained by the controller within a tolerable range of the default PID settings. The auto-tune feature will increase control stability and precision to within one degree. Most of the time, users don't need to toggle the perplexing PID parameters in order to stabilize the system.

More than twenty different input sensors/devices are supported by this industrial-grade PID controller with excellent precision and full features, covering practically all application needs. There are more than ten programmable ways to trigger two alarm outputs. Even when the controller is turned off, all of the control and setting parameters are kept in its non-volatile memory. When using a thermocouple sensor, recently incorporated advanced cold junction compensation circuits substantially reduce temperature drift.

This unit has 12VDC output for controlling an external solid-state relay (SSR).

Main Specifications

Input type

(Note 2)

TC: K, E, S, WRe, J, T, B, N
RTD: Pt100, Cu50, 0-80 ohm, 0-400 ohm.
DC voltage : 0~20 mV, 0-100 mv, 0~5V, 1~5V, 0~1V, -100~100mV, -20~20mV, -5~5V, 0.2~1V.
DC current: 4~20mA.
Input range K (-60~2300ºF), S (-60~3100ºF), WRe (32~4150ºF), T (-330~660ºF), E (32~1500ºF),
J (32~1800ºF), B (32~3300ºF), N (32~2400ºF), Pt100 (-320~1100ºF), Cu50 (-60~300ºF).
Linear input: -1999~+9999 defined by a user.
Display Two lines, Four digits. °F or °C.
Display Resolution
(Note 2)
1°C or 1°F, and 0.1°C (note 2)
Accuracy ±0.2% or ±1 unit of the full input range
Control mode Fuzzy PID, Manual control, On-Off
Output mode 12 V DC for external solid-state relay (SSR)
Alarm Process high/low alarm, deviation high/low alarm
Alarm output Relay contact (Resistive): 1A at 240VAC, 3A at120VAC, or 3A at 24VAC
Power supply
voltage rating
85~265 VAC / 50~60Hz
Mounting cutout 1.77" x 1.77" (45 x 45 mm), 1/16 DIN
Overall dimension 1.89" x 1.89" x 3.94" (48 x 48 x 100 mm) 


Wi-Fi Connectivity Specifications

Wireless Standards 2.4 GHz, IEEE 802.11 b/g/n
Security Protocols WPA/WPA2/WPA2-Enterprise
